Reading DVD movies to DLNA compliant HDTV-Stream DVD Movies to Panasonic VIERA Series HDTV

Streaming DVD movie to Panasonic VIERA Series HDTV is not as easy as streaming MPG videos clips. In the first place, DVD movies are copy-protected, and you have to rip movies off. Besides, although DVD movies are MPEG-2 encoded videos, they are enveloped in .vob format, which is not a native streaming media format. So you have to .vob to .mpg, .avi or other streaming media format. More or less, you suffer some quality loss when decoding DVD videos. Is there any way to convert DVD to streaming media format without quality loss? The following guide shows you how to convert DVD to .mpg video while keeping original video, audio and subtitles so as to stream DVD movies to DLNA compliant Panasonic VIERA Series HDTV from a networked PC or DLNA media server.

How to convert a DVD to TS for streaming to Panasonic VIERA Series HDTV

I. Convert DVD to MKV without quality loss

Required software- Pavtube ByteCopy (Click here to download a trial)



1. Load DVD to Pavtube ByteCopy.

2. Select the movie (G:\)

3. Set output mode



4. Select “Lossless” from the drop-down list of “Format”

5. Convert DVD to MKV with original video, audio and subtitles.

The above process helps you bypass the DVD copy-protections, extract video, audio, subtitles streams and chapter info from DVD, and package them to MKV container. If you don’t want some subtitles or audio tracks, e.g. French language, simply uncheck them from subtitles or audio languages.

II. Remux MKV to MPG with multiple subtitles

Required software- Pavtube Blu-ray Video Converter Ultimate



1. Load MKV to Pavtube Blu-ray Video Converter Ultimate

2. Click “Format” to set output format



3. Follow “Remux” and select “MPEG-PS (*.mpg)” format

4. Start remuxing MKV to MPG video with original video, audio and subtitles.

This process helps you remux MKV to MPG video. Remuxing is the process of demuxing a container format and muxing it back together in a different container without changing anything. Remuxing is not losing any quality as it only repackaging the audio and video streams. And it takes less time than encoding as well.

Streaming DVD video to DLNA compliant HDTV

Why DLNA? Cause DLNA make it easy to stream photos, music and videos between TVs, DVD and Blu-ray players, games consoles, digital media players, photo frames, cameras, NAS devices, PCs, mobile handsets, and more. (Learn more about DLNA in Wiki).

If you’re streaming DVD video from PC to Panasonic VIERA Series HDTV, Windows Media Player is good enough for video streaming over home media network (learn how to set up WMP for streaming). If you’re sharing videos from NAS device, Twonky is recommended as best DLNA media server software. Make sure your HDTV and PC/NAS are connected to the home network and your HDTV is DLNA compliant before streaming DVD to HDTV.

Blu-ray to Toshiba Thrive Converter – Rip Blu-ray to Thrive for playback



With its high-resolution 10.1-inch multi-touch widescreen display, Toshiba Thrive Tablet is well-sized for watching movies, surfing the net, playing games, reading books and more. With an NVIDIA® GeForce® GPU, you can not only experience console-quality gaming performance, but also HD video playback. Have you ever thought of watching your Blu-ray movies on this amazing tablet? A commercial Blu-ray movie comes with copy-protection and m2ts streams incompatible with Thrive, so if you wanna watch Blu-ray on the Thrive tablet, you need use a Blu-ray to Toshiba Thrive Converter to remove BD encryption, and meanwhile convert it to thrive playable file format.

For your reference: Multimedia Playback capability of Thrive

- Audio compatibility: MP3, WMA, AAC, eAAC+, Ogg Vorbis, WAVE

- Video compatibility: MPEG4, H.263, H.264

Here is a guide on how to rip Blu-ray to Thrive for playback via using Pavtube Blu-ray to Toshiba Thrive Converter.

Step 1: Down load the free trial version of Pavtube Blu-ray to Toshiba Thrive Converter (note: the video files generated by the trial version come with pavtube watermark in the center of the video), install and run it. Click the Blu-ray disc icon, or the Blu-ray folder icon to load the source Blu-ray directly from your BD drive or from the Blu-ray movie folder on your computer hard drive.



Tips – About CUDA:



Note that CUDA is accessible only when there is an NVIDIA graphics card that supports GPU en-decoding acceleration. The CUDA button will be grayed out/denied when the software fails to detect a satisfactory NVIDIA graphics card. And The CUDA works only when creating H.264 encoded video files. Learn more about Pavtube software supported graphics cards

Step 2: Select your wanted audio track and subs track to be kept in the output file.

Step 3: Click “Format” menu to select “Common Video” > “H.264 Video (*.mp4)” as output format.



Step 4: Click on “Settings” button to optimize video and audio settings for output files.

Following are the recommended best settings for Toshiba Thrive:

Video

Codec: h264

Size(pix): 1280*752

Bitrate(kbps): 2250

Frame rate(fps): 30

Audio

Codec: aac

Sample rate(hz): 44100

Bitrate(bps): 160000

Channels: Stereo



Step 5: Rip Blu-ray to Thrive for playback

Click “Convert” button to start making Blu-ray playable with Thrive. When the conversion is done, you can simply click “Open” button to get the final output files. Add the ripped Blu-ray movie file to your Thrive tablet, and enjoy!

How to convert Canon Powershot S95 MOV HD to AVI/WMV video for editing?

Why we love the Canon PowerShot S95? Particularly because it not only delivers spectacular photos, but also lets you record video in beautiful high definition (1280 x 720 pixels). The camera also makes it easy to enjoy HD videos and still photos on your HDTV. It’s great that the Canon S95 can shoot in 720 HD but when loading the H.264/MOV videos for editing, many new users get involved in issues like load error and momentary glitch. This is because the HD MOV clips are encoded in H.264 codec, a most advanced codec that compresses video in highest compression ratio, but not so acceptable for editing software such as Magix Edit Pro, Sony Vegas, and Adobe Premiere. Generally speaking, editing software prefer AVI, WMV, MPG to H.264 encoded MOV, MTS, TOD footage.



If you’re caught by the editing issues of Canon Powershot S95 footage, I advise you converts the H.264 MOV files to AVI or WMV with Pavtube HD Video Converter before editing. Why Pavtube HD Video Converter? Basically, it does a good job in converting H.264 .mov files to AVI, WMV formats for editing in sync and not looses much quality. And it allows you to join the Canon Powershot S95 clips together, and add audio track to the video as background music. Does it convert MOV to AVI fast? Well I haven’t found a faster one so far.

Downloaded a trial of Pavtube HD Video Converter and get your Canon Powershot S95 .mov files converted to .avi or .wmv format as it shows below:

Step 1. Load H.264 .mov footage to Canon Powershot S95 MOV Converter.

Transfer h.264 encoded .mov files from Canon Powershot S95 camcorder to your computer via USB cable. Run Pavtube HD Video Converter, and click the “Add” button to load H.264/MOV videos.



Step 2. Set AVI/WMV as output format for editing.

Click “Format” bar to determine output format. Follow “Common Video” and select any format from “AVI MSMPEG4-V3 (*.avi)”, “WMV3 (WMV9)(*.wmv)” and “WMV2 (WMV8)(*.wmv)”.



Step 3. Adjust video and audio settings to optimize output file quality

Click “Settings” button, then you will be able to adjust audio and video parameters on the popup window to customize the output file quality, these adjustable parameters include codec name, aspect ratio, bit rate, frame rate, sample rate, and audio channel. To maintain original HD quality, you may set “original” in the fields of “Size”, “Bitrate” and “Frame rate”. To downsize the Canon Powershot S95 .mov files, just set a smaller bitrate.



Step 4. Click “Convert” button to convert Canon Powershot S95 MOV files to HD AVI/WMV.

Once the conversion is finished by Canon Powershot S95 MOV to AVI/WMV Converter, you can click “Open” button to get the output files effortlessly. Now you have got it right, just import and edit S95 MOV files with Sony Vegas Platinum, Adobe Premiere or any other editing software you like.

Additional editing features of the Pavtube HD Video Converter:

Deinterlace- click “Editor”, switch to “Effect” tab, find “Deinterlacing” box, and check it to eliminate interlacing lines.

Combine files together- check the files to be merged in file list and check “Merge into one” box beside “Settings” button.

Trim a section of the movie- click “Editor”, switch to “Trim” tab, and input time point in start and end box.

Thumbnail- click “Snapshoot” button when previewing the video. Click “Option” to set the image format of screenshots.

FLV for YouTube and Flikr- click “Format” and choose “Flash Video”>> “FLV H.264 (*.flv)” as output format if you’d like to share your Powershot S95 shootings to YouTube or Flikr.

How to convert Canon T3i footage to ProRes 422 for FCP?

Canon Rebel T3i (EOS 600D in Europe) is an upper entry-level DSLR. It uses the 18MP CMOS sensor seen in the Rebel T2i (550D), but gets a tilt and swivel 1,040k dot LCD monitor like the more expensive 60D.Plus it gains the ability to remotely control flashguns using its internal flash, usually found only on higher-end models.This Canon camera package includes the 18-55mm F3.5-5.6 IS II lens, a cosmetically revised version of its optically stabilized kit lens.

The videos are saved in .mov with H.264 as video codec and Linear PCM as audio codec.

After shooting some footage on the 600D, you may want to edit them in Final Cut Pro. Some users have reported abut the choppy output video from Final Cut Pro 6, and there are lags or skipped frames even when exported to 30fps.



Pavtube Video Converter for Mac is the first choice for you to make smooth videos for editing in FCP.It makes it easy to convert Canon T3i footage to ProRes 422 for FCP.

Step 1. Download Canon 600D MOV files to Pavtube Video Converter for Mac

Run Pavtube Video Converter for Mac as the best Canon EOS 600D H.264 MOV to ProRes MOV converter on Mac OS X. Click the “Add” button to import .mov files from the camera.

Step 2. Choose MOV format with ProRes 422

Click the “Format” option, and navigate to Final Cut Pro > Apple ProRes 422 (*.mov) as output format. The Mac Digital SLR camera video converter will convert H.264 mov to prores 422 mov.

Step 3. Choose 1080p size with 29.97

Click the “Settings” button and choose 1920*1080 from the video size drop-down box to keep the original HD resolution and 16:9 aspect ratio. Click the drop-down box for frame rate, and you can choose 29.97fps.

Step 4. Convert DSLR video to ProRes 422 HQ MOV for FCP

Click the convert button under the preview window, the Mac Canon 600D DSLR video converter will start converting DSLR video to ProRes 422 in full HD 1080p for FCP editing.

Hope you enjoy the optimal way to convert Canon H.264 mov to ProRes 422 for FCP 7 and 6, so that you can edit the H.264 files easily.

Video to Archos 70 – Convert video to a format that plays correctly on Archos 70



The Archos 70 Android tablet includes a capable 1GHz processor, capacitive 7-inch touch screen, front-facing camera, Bluetooth, HDMI output capability, and up to 250GB of storage.

The Archos 70 home tablet is a wonderful device for enjoying and sharing your multimedia content. The tablet supports H.264 and MPEG-4 codec, and plays videos of .avi, .mp4, .mkv, .mov, and .flv most of the time. Yeah, most of the time. Things happen that you copy an AVI file to Archos 70 and the device will not play it. Any way to make the Archos 70 play all kinds of videos?

Generally, video contents that play correctly on Archos 70 tablet must be encoded with correct codec (H.264 or MPEG-4), packaged in correct container format (above mentioned formats) and created in correct size, bitrate and framerate (720p, 2.5mbps, 30fps at most). Now I’m sure you understand why H.264 encoded MKV video files of 1920*1080 can not be played on Archos 70. In case a video file is not supported by Archos 70 tablet, you need to convert the video to Archos 70 compatible file format.

Pavtube Video to Archos 70 Converter is recommended as a best tool to help you complete the Video to Archos 70 conversion. This software converts a given video file to the format that will play correctly on your Archos 70 and other Archos home tablets and guarantees perfect synchronization. You may download and install trial of Pavtube Video to Archos 70 Converter and try it out. Step-by-Step guide of converting and transferring Video to Archos:

Step 1: Run Pavtube Video to Archos 70 Converter and import source video files.

To convert Video to Archos 70, you can click “Add Video” to load video source. The Pavtube Video converter supports multiple video formats and codec, such as H.264, MPEG-4, MPEG-2, Xvid, TS, AVI, MP4, WMV, MKV, MOV, TOD, M2TS, MTS, MOD, VOB, TiVo and more.



Step 2. Set video format for Archos 70 tablet

To play videos on Archos 70, you need to set a compatible format for the tablet. Pavtube Video Converter provides users with presets for Archos 5, Archos 7, Archos 605, Archos 705, Archos 704, Archos 504, Archos 604, etc, so you may click on the pull down menu of “Format”, and select a specific format of your Archos tab. The “Archos 5/7 AVI Video (*.avi) is recommended when converting SD (4:3) video to Archos.



Step 3: Put and play videos on Archos 70

Click “Convert” button to start converting Video to Archos. After conversion completes you can click the “Open” button to find the converted files. Now the source videos can be put and played on Archos 70 for entertainment.
